Overview
Throughout the Political Science program from Saint John Fisher College, you will learn through discussion of texts and cases, simulations, research reports, and internship experiences. In addition to required Core classes, political science electives make up the rest of the credit hours necessary to achieve your bachelor of arts degree in this discipline.
Courses within the program are informally organized by subfields: political theory, American government, legal studies, comparative politics, and international relations. As a political science major, you are encouraged to choose electives within the subfield of your choosing, thereby tailoring the program to meet your interests and needs.
Within this program, you also are encouraged to pursue a second major. Fisher offers several programs in fields that are relevant to political science, such as international studies, economics, and legal studies.
Life After Fisher
With a degree in political science, you will be prepared for careers in government, politics, education, or business and industry. Alumni of the political science program have gone on to jobs in areas and for organizations such as:
- State and local public administration
- Civil service
- Foreign service
- Nonprofit agencies
- United Nations
- Research consulting agencies
- Armed Forces

Other requirements
General requirements
- Fisher's Application for Admission (apply through the Common Application)
- Original or notarized copies of academic records from all secondary (high school) schools attended.
- International students must submit at least one of the following:
- SAT (Scholastic Aptitude Test) or ACT (American College Testing) test scores.
- Results of Test of English as a Foreign Language (TOEFL), DuoLingo or International English Language Testing System (IELTS) if a student's first language is not English.
- A Counselor/Teacher Recommendation.
- A 250-word minimum personal statement or essay on a topic of the applicant's choice.
